static void zend_accel_class_hash_copy(HashTable *target, HashTable *source)
{
	Bucket *p, *end;
	zval *t;

	zend_hash_extend(target, target->nNumUsed + source->nNumUsed, 0);
	p = source->arData;
	end = p + source->nNumUsed;
	for (; p != end; p++) {
		ZEND_ASSERT(Z_TYPE(p->val) != IS_UNDEF);
		ZEND_ASSERT(p->key);
		t = zend_hash_find_known_hash(target, p->key);
		if (UNEXPECTED(t != NULL)) {
			if (EXPECTED(ZSTR_LEN(p->key) > 0) && EXPECTED(ZSTR_VAL(p->key)[0] == 0)) {
				/* Runtime definition key. There are two circumstances under which the key can
				 * already be defined:
				 *  1. The file has been re-included without being changed in the meantime. In
				 *     this case we can keep the old value, because we know that the definition
				 *     hasn't changed.
				 *  2. The file has been changed in the meantime, but the RTD key ends up colliding.
				 *     This would be a bug.
				 * As we can't distinguish these cases, we assume that it is 1. and keep the old
				 * value. */
				continue;
			} else if (UNEXPECTED(!ZCG(accel_directives).ignore_dups)) {
				zend_class_entry *ce1 = Z_PTR(p->val);
				if (!(ce1->ce_flags & ZEND_ACC_ANON_CLASS)) {
					CG(in_compilation) = 1;
					zend_set_compiled_filename(ce1->info.user.filename);
					CG(zend_lineno) = ce1->info.user.line_start;
					zend_error(E_ERROR,
							"Cannot declare %s %s, because the name is already in use",
							zend_get_object_type(ce1), ZSTR_VAL(ce1->name));
					return;
				}
				continue;
			}
		} else {
			zend_class_entry *ce = Z_PTR(p->val);
			t = _zend_hash_append_ptr_ex(target, p->key, Z_PTR(p->val), 1);
			if ((ce->ce_flags & ZEND_ACC_LINKED)
			 && ZSTR_HAS_CE_CACHE(ce->name)
			 && ZSTR_VAL(p->key)[0]) {
				ZSTR_SET_CE_CACHE_EX(ce->name, ce, 0);
			}
		}
	}
	target->nInternalPointer = 0;
	return;
}

#define ADLER32_BASE 65521 /* largest prime smaller than 65536 */
#define ADLER32_NMAX 5552
/* NMAX is the largest n such that 255n(n+1)/2 + (n+1)(BASE-1) <= 2^32-1 */

#define ADLER32_DO1(buf)        {s1 += *(buf); s2 += s1;}
#define ADLER32_DO2(buf, i)     ADLER32_DO1(buf + i); ADLER32_DO1(buf + i + 1);
#define ADLER32_DO4(buf, i)     ADLER32_DO2(buf, i); ADLER32_DO2(buf, i + 2);
#define ADLER32_DO8(buf, i)     ADLER32_DO4(buf, i); ADLER32_DO4(buf, i + 4);
#define ADLER32_DO16(buf)       ADLER32_DO8(buf, 0); ADLER32_DO8(buf, 8);

unsigned int zend_adler32(unsigned int checksum, unsigned char *buf, uint32_t len)
{
	unsigned int s1 = checksum & 0xffff;
	unsigned int s2 = (checksum >> 16) & 0xffff;
	unsigned char *end;

	while (len >= ADLER32_NMAX) {
		len -= ADLER32_NMAX;
		end = buf + ADLER32_NMAX;
		do {
			ADLER32_DO16(buf);
			buf += 16;
		} while (buf != end);
		s1 %= ADLER32_BASE;
		s2 %= ADLER32_BASE;
	}

	if (len) {
		if (len >= 16) {
			end = buf + (len & 0xfff0);
			len &= 0xf;
			do {
				ADLER32_DO16(buf);
				buf += 16;
			} while (buf != end);
		}
		if (len) {
			end = buf + len;
			do {
				ADLER32_DO1(buf);
				buf++;
			} while (buf != end);
		}
		s1 %= ADLER32_BASE;
		s2 %= ADLER32_BASE;
	}

	return (s2 << 16) | s1;
}
